P圜harm, a product of JetBrains, is relatively new to the market, starting as late as 2010 when it released its beta version for the first time. JetBrains developed this IDE with the intention of streamlining Python development.

An IDE (Integrated Development Environment) is ideal for large amounts of text as it allows users to quickly, edit, run, and debug their code with out-of-the-box features such as auto-text completion and an auto-debugger.
